Harmattan AI at a glance

France's first defense-tech unicorn, building attritable AI-piloted strike, interception, and ISR drones for allied militaries.

Harmattan AI is a vertically integrated defense prime building autonomous drone systems for allied militaries. It designs the full stack, from airframes and payloads to embedded compute and the autonomy algorithms that let drones sense, decide, and act at the edge without GPS or a network link, coordinated across a swarm by its mission-orchestration layer.

ABOUT THE ROLE

As a Multi-Agents Mission Planning Engineer, you’ll design and implement the Guidance, Navigation, and Control algorithms that translate high-level mission goals into actionable guidance for autonomous robots and multi-agent systems. You’ll bridge cutting-edge research and field-ready autonomy, ensuring our systems are both intelligent and predictable in live operations.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Design algorithms that decompose high-level missions into structured, solvable guidance tasks for autonomous robots.
  • Develop and optimize mission and path-planning frameworks for autonomous systems.
  • Build scalable backend integrations for mission guidance and execution.
  • Run simulations and validation campaigns to assess autonomy consistency across diverse mission types.
  • Partner with AI/ML, backend, and product teams to ensure algorithms are efficient, testable, and deployable in real-time environment

CANDIDATE REQUIREMENTS

  • Education: Ph.D. or M.S. in Aerospace Engineering, Robotics, Applied Math, AI, or related field. A PhD in the field of multi-agent systems or reinforcement learning is a huge plus.
  • Experience designing and deploying mission- or path-planning algorithms in aerospace, defense, or robotics is a huge plus
  • Technical Skills: Strong coding in Python and C++ . Deep understanding of autonomous decision-making, multi-agent coordination, and simulation frameworks.
